■(TB) 'Full Dress'
1960, Brown
'Full Dress' (
Opal Brown, R. 1959). Seedling# 8-20-B19. TB, 36" (91 cm), Midseason bloom. Aureolin-yellow self; saffron-yellow beard.
'Gay Princess' x
'Country Cuzzin'. Sunnyhills 1960. High Commendation 1959, as seedling# 8-20-B19; Honorable Mention 1960.
See below:
References:
Opal Brown's FULL DRESS, one of the brightest stars in the garden constellation, is a vibrant yellow self with fine intricate lacing, large globular flowers and good growth habits. Melba Hamblen, "Honors, Review and Preview", A.I.S. Bulletin 164 (Jan. 1962): 15. |
From Fleur De Lis Gardens catalog 1963: FULL DRESS (O. Brown '60) M. 34 in. Gay Princess x Country Cuzzin. A heavily laced bright yellow with dark saffron yellow beard. Form is good and substance is heavy. H.M. 1960. NET 12.00. |
